Volunteers needed to remove invasive plants along the Highlands Greenway

Highlands Plateau Greenway needs volunteers to help remove non-native invasive plants on Saturday, Feb. 18.

Volunteers will meet at the back parking lot of the Highlands Rec Park at 9 a.m. 

In partnership with the Coalition for Non-native Invasive Plant Management (CNIPM), volunteers will be removing Privet and Oriental Bittersweet from the Rec Park.

Please bring gloves, loppers, hand saws, and a determination to kill privet.This will be the first step in an effort to restore this forested area to a more beneficial landscape for our community, and the community’s help is greatly appreciated.

Crews will finish at noon and go to lunch at 4118.
